禁用Hyper技术:解锁系统新性能
禁用hyper的代码

首页 2024-12-13 22:02:16



禁用Hyper:保障系统安全与性能的必要之举 在当今的数字化时代,软件开发与系统管理日益复杂,各类技术工具和框架层出不穷,为开发者提供了极大的便利

    然而,在这些技术中,Hyper——作为一种常见的虚拟化技术或框架(此处Hyper为泛指,实际可能指代如Hyper-V、Docker HyperKit等具体技术)——在某些特定场景下,却可能成为系统安全与性能的潜在威胁

    因此,禁用Hyper的代码成为了确保系统稳定运行、保护数据安全的重要措施

    本文将从安全、性能、资源管理和合规性四个方面,详细阐述禁用Hyper的必要性,并提供实际操作指南

     一、安全性的考量 1. 隔离机制的潜在漏洞 Hyper技术通过虚拟化技术实现了资源的隔离与共享,这一特性在提升资源利用率的同时,也带来了潜在的安全风险

    虚拟化层可能成为攻击者渗透系统的桥梁,一旦虚拟化环境被攻破,攻击者可以轻易地在不同虚拟机之间跳跃,甚至访问宿主机资源,造成严重的安全后果

    禁用Hyper可以从根本上消除这一安全隐患,减少攻击面

     2. 敏感数据泄露风险 在虚拟化环境中,数据往往以文件或镜像的形式存储,若虚拟化平台存在安全漏洞或配置不当,敏感数据可能面临泄露风险

    特别是当Hyper技术被用于处理包含个人隐私、商业秘密等敏感信息的系统时,这种风险尤为突出

    禁用Hyper可以有效降低数据泄露的可能性,因为数据将直接运行在物理硬件上,减少了中间层的干预

     二、性能优化的需求 1. 减少资源消耗 虚拟化技术虽然提高了资源利用率,但也引入了额外的资源开销,如CPU调度、内存管理、磁盘I/O等方面的性能损耗

    对于对性能要求极高的应用场景,如高频交易系统、实时数据分析等,这些损耗可能直接影响业务效率

    禁用Hyper可以消除这些性能瓶颈,使应用程序直接运行在硬件上,从而最大化利用系统资源,提升整体性能

     2. 避免虚拟化层带来的延迟 虚拟化环境中的网络延迟和存储延迟是另一个不可忽视的问题

    虽然现代虚拟化技术已经通过诸如SR-IOV(Single Root Input/Output Virtualization)等技术来减少这些延迟,但在某些极端情况下,这些延迟仍然可能对实时性要求高的应用造成负面影响

    禁用Hyper可以消除虚拟化层带来的所有延迟,确保应用的响应速度达到最优

     三、资源管理的简化 1. 降低运维复杂度 虚拟化技术的引入增加了系统的复杂性,运维人员需要掌握更多的技能和知识来管理虚拟化环境,包括虚拟机生命周期管理、资源分配与调度、故障排查等

    禁用Hyper可以简化运维流程,减少运维人员的学习成本和工作量,提高运维效率

     2. 避免虚拟化环境的兼容性问题 虚拟化环境往往与特定的操作系统、硬件平台以及应用程序存在兼容性问题

    这些问题可能导致应用程序无法正常运行或性能下降

    禁用Hyper可以避免这些兼容性问题,确保应用程序在原生环境中稳定运行,减少因兼容性问题导致的维护成本

     四、合规性与审计要求 1. 满足特定行业的安全合规要求 在某些高度监管的行业,如金融、医疗等,安全合规是业务运营的基础

    这些行业往往对数据处理、存储和传输有着严格的规定,虚拟化环境可能因其复杂性而难以满足这些规定

    禁用Hyper可以简化系统架构,使其更容易满足合规要求,降低因违规操作带来的法律风险

     2. 便于审计与监控 虚拟化环境中的资源分配和访问控制往往比物理环境更加复杂,这增加了审计和监控的难度

    禁用Hyper可以使系统架构更加透明,便于审计人员对系统资源的使用情况进行跟踪和审计,确保系统操作符合规定

     实际操作指南:禁用Hyper 禁用Hyper的具体步骤因具体技术而异,以下以Windows系统中的Hyper-V为例,简要介绍禁用过程: 1.打开“控制面板”:在Windows系统中,点击“开始”菜单,选择“控制面板”

     2.进入“程序和功能”:在控制面板中,找到并点击“程序和功能”

     3.启用或关闭Windows功能:在程序和功能窗口中,点击左侧的“启用或关闭Windows功能”

     4.取消勾选Hyper-V:在弹出的窗口中,找到“Hyper-V”选项,取消其勾选状态

     5.重启计算机:完成上述设置后,点击“确定”并重启计算机,以应用更改

     对于其他虚拟化技术,如Docker的HyperKit,禁用过程可能涉及修改配置文件、卸载相关软件包或禁用相关服务,具体步骤需参考相